QUITE SIMPLY ONE OF THE BEST! Run, dont walk, to discover The Meadows! Located in the much sought-after Toro Park Elementary/San Benancio Middle School Districts, youll enjoy resort-style living with a park, clubhouse, pool, tennis, and a playground steps away. This 2,868-square-foot home offers 4 bedrooms, 3 baths, and an office. Soaring ceilings and natural light abound. Updated three years ago, the home features a stunning kitchen, baths, and elegant tile flooring downstairs. Additional upgrades include a Life Source water filtration system, window coverings, lighting, and door hardware. Spoil yourself in the Primary Suite Retreat, highlighted by a spa-like bathroom with a freestanding tub, shower, and generous walk-in closet. The outdoors is beautifully landscaped, including a vibrant backyard with water-saving turf. By the front door is a charming spot offering park views and the pleasure of engaging with strolling neighbors. Maybe the best thing . . . its one of those houses that just feels like home!

Within a 1-2 mile radius of 14390 Mountain Quail Road, residents have access to several parks. Toro County Park is a large day-use park offering extensive hiking trails, playgrounds, and picnic areas. Additionally, local parks like Frank Paul Park, Closter Park, and Gene Robertson Park are accessible for recreation.
The neighborhood is part of "The Meadows" in the San Benancio, Harper Cyn, Corral De Tierra, Rim Rock area of Salinas. This community offers resort-style living with amenities such as a park, clubhouse, pool, tennis courts, and a playground. Salinas itself is described as a growing community with a collection of inviting neighborhoods.
This location has a Walk Score of 24 out of 100, indicating it is a car-dependent neighborhood where most errands require a vehicle. There are a few nearby public transportation options, including bus lines 41, 42, 45, and 95, all located approximately 0.4 miles away. The nearest transit hub for regional routes is the Intermodal Transportation Center in Downtown Salinas.
